As a Global Project Head within R&D Vaccines, you will serve as the strategic leader and driving force behind the development and execution of integrated strategies and development plans for New Vaccines (NV) projects from Gate M2 through the end of development. This pivotal role places you at the intersection of science, strategy, and leadership, where you will orchestrate cross-functional collaboration to bring life-saving vaccines to patients worldwide. In this position, you will lead Global Project Teams (GPT) and sub-teams in close cooperation with R&D and non-R&D function heads, ensuring seamless alignment across all development activities. You will be accountable for project risk management and will serve as the primary communicator to governance committees, providing strategic insights and recommendations that shape project direction. Your leadership will extend beyond internal teams as you serve as a key member of the Franchise Steering Team and Brand Team, contributing to broader strategic decisions.

As the ambassador for your project both internally and externally, you will build and maintain relationships with stakeholders across the organization and with external partners, including NGOs, partner companies, academic institutions, and joint ventures. Your ability to align diverse stakeholders, navigate complex organizational dynamics, and champion project objectives will be critical to success. Main Responsibilities:

Product Development Strategy & Execution
  • Contributes to creation and implementation of high-level product development strategies including Target Product/Vaccine Profile (TPP/TVP)
  • Hold full accountability for developing and executing project strategy from Gate M2 through licensure, ensuring alignment with organizational objectives and patient needs
  • Drive strategic decision-making that balances scientific innovation, commercial viability, and patient impact
  • Ensure project deliverables meet timelines, quality standards and regulatory requirements across all markets


Team Leadership
  • Structure and lead the Global Project Team, fostering a collaborative, high-performance culture
  • Set clear objectives, provide constructive feedback, and hold team members accountable for deliverables
  • Mentor and develop team members, building capabilities across the organization
  • Create an inclusive environment where diverse perspectives are valued and leveraged


Project Management
  • Deliver projects on-time, within budget, and in accordance with strategic objectives
  • Monitor project milestones and proactively address obstacles to maintain momentum
  • Ensure seamless coordination across all functional areas and geographies


Resource Management
  • Supervise project activities and resolve resource utilization issues across functions
  • Optimize allocation of budget, personnel, and materials to maximize project efficiency
  • Partner with functional leaders to secure necessary resources and capabilities Make data-driven decisions regarding resource prioritization and trade-offs


Strategic Planning
  • Translate TPP into comprehensive scope, objectives, and actionable plans
  • Ensure alignment across Integrated Early Global Plan (IEGP), Integrated Strategic Commercial Plan (iSCP), Clinical Development Plan (CDP), Technical Strategy Document (TSD), and Global Regulatory Plan and Strategy (GRPS)

About You

We're looking for a strategic leader who combines scientific expertise with business acumen and exceptional people leadership skills. You thrive in complex, matrixed environments and have a track record of delivering results through collaboration and influence.

Required Qualifications :
  • Masters of Science degree in scientific-related field of study. PhD, MD, or PharmD is preferred.
  • 7 years of experience in vaccine development in pharmaceutical, biotechnology, or related discipline.
